The 'Lifie' pendant lamp, designed by Jo Hammerborg for Fog & Mørup in Denmark in 1977, exemplifies late Scandinavian modernism of the 1970s. Its broad, conical shade is crafted from metal in a deep, matte dark brown, with a smooth finish and invisible joints. Two cylindrical elements above and below the shade, made of metal with a satin-brushed golden finish, introduce subtle highlights and a refined color contrast. The lamp is suspended from a thin, black textile cord, emphasizing its minimalist character. The proportions are precisely balanced, and the construction demonstrates the high level of craftsmanship characteristic of the Danish Fog & Mørup manufacture. Light is diffused evenly across the surface of the shade, creating a soft glow.
